Official Description

A remote code execution vulnerability in Remote Desktop Manager 2023.2.33 and earlier on Windows allows an attacker to remotely execute code from another windows user session on the same host via a specially crafted TCP packet.

Risk Analysis

Remote Desktop Manager is affected by a remote code execution vulnerability that allows an attacker to execute code from another user session via a crafted TCP packet. This critical flaw is remotely exploitable and carries a 9.8 CVSS score. It poses a significant threat to Windows environments running the software.

There is no known public exploit, and the vulnerability is not listed in the CISA KEV catalog.

Recommended Action

Update Remote Desktop Manager to a version beyond 2023.2.33 and ensure Windows systems are fully patched.

Technical Analysis

CVE-2023-5766 can be exploited remotely over the network without requiring physical or adjacent access, significantly expanding the attack surface for threat actors.

The vulnerability requires no privileges and no user interaction, making it a prime target for automated exploitation campaigns and worm-like propagation.

A successful exploit results in complete confidentiality breach (data exposure), full integrity compromise (data manipulation), availability disruption (denial of service), with a CVSS base score of 9.8.
